2026/1/2 10:52:44
网站建设
项目流程
深圳网站设计g,软件工程培训机构,建设官方网站多少,飞扬动力网站建设5步掌握prompt优化器#xff1a;Vue3 TypeScript架构深度解析 【免费下载链接】prompt-optimizer 一款提示词优化器#xff0c;助力于编写高质量的提示词 项目地址: https://gitcode.com/GitHub_Trending/pro/prompt-optimizer
prompt-optimizer是一款基于Vue3和Type…5步掌握prompt优化器Vue3 TypeScript架构深度解析【免费下载链接】prompt-optimizer一款提示词优化器助力于编写高质量的提示词项目地址: https://gitcode.com/GitHub_Trending/pro/prompt-optimizerprompt-optimizer是一款基于Vue3和TypeScript构建的提示词优化工具旨在帮助用户编写高质量的提示词提升与AI模型交互的效果。该项目采用现代化的前端技术栈通过组件化设计和类型安全保证为开发者提供了一套完整的提示词工程解决方案。通过本指南您将深入了解如何构建高效、可维护的前端架构。架构设计理念与核心思想prompt-optimizer项目的架构设计遵循关注点分离和单一职责原则将复杂的前端应用拆分为多个独立的模块。整个项目采用monorepo架构通过workspace机制管理多个子包确保代码复用性和模块独立性。项目的主要架构层次包括核心服务层packages/core/、UI组件层packages/ui/、Web应用层packages/web/以及桌面端应用层packages/desktop/。每个层次都有明确的职责边界通过定义清晰的接口进行通信。技术选型依据与优势分析Vue3作为核心框架的选择基于其优秀的组合式API设计能够更好地支持大型应用的逻辑复用。TypeScript的引入为项目提供了静态类型检查大大提升了代码质量和开发效率。Vue3组合式API的应用 项目中大量使用Composables模式如usePerformanceMonitor、usePromptOptimizer等将业务逻辑封装为可复用的函数避免组件间的代码重复。TypeScript类型系统的深度集成 从组件props到业务逻辑全面采用TypeScript类型定义。这种设计不仅提升了代码的可读性还能够在编译阶段发现潜在的类型错误。开发流程规范与团队协作项目的开发流程严格遵循现代前端工程化标准。通过pnpm workspace管理依赖确保各包版本一致性。构建系统采用Vite提供快速的开发体验和优化的生产构建。代码组织结构规范组件统一放置在packages/ui/src/components/目录下业务逻辑通过Composables封装在packages/ui/src/composables/目录中类型定义集中在packages/ui/src/types/目录下代码质量保障体系项目建立了完整的代码质量保障机制包括ESLint代码规范检查、Vitest单元测试、Playwright端到端测试等。组件设计最佳实践 每个Vue组件都采用script setup语法结合TypeScript提供类型安全。组件间通过props和emit进行数据传递确保数据流的清晰可控。扩展性与维护性设计架构设计充分考虑了未来的功能扩展需求。通过插件化设计和依赖注入模式新功能可以无缝集成到现有系统中。模块化设计原则✨ 每个功能模块都是独立的可以单独开发、测试和部署。这种设计不仅提升了开发效率还降低了系统的维护成本。通过以上五个关键步骤prompt-optimizer项目构建了一套完整的前端架构解决方案。这种架构设计不仅适用于提示词优化器项目也可以为其他Vue3 TypeScript项目提供参考。项目的成功实践证明了现代前端技术在复杂应用开发中的强大能力。【免费下载链接】prompt-optimizer一款提示词优化器助力于编写高质量的提示词项目地址: https://gitcode.com/GitHub_Trending/pro/prompt-optimizer创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考